Hi,
I'm a international student of Niagara College. I'm studying a Post-secondary Program nowand this is my first semester. But I want to change to Graduate Program in Sep, and hopefully will graduate in April next year. I will finish four semesters and 75 credits totally. The first two semesters belong to the Post-secondary Program and the next two semesters belong to the Graduate Program. And I will get a Ontario College Graduate Certificate finally.
I want to know after I finish my study, am I eligible for a three years post-graduation work permit?
Ok , if you complete both programs, and have certificate for both , Then you get a 2 year work permit , for studying 2 academic year.
If you do one program and leave the previous program in between , then only one year work permit.
And if you take a program of 2 years [same program] , then you get a 3 year work permit.
